Ronaldo record as Real grab win

-

CRISTIANO RONALDO became the first player to score in all six Champions League group games as holders Real Madrid beat Borussia Dortmund 3-2 last night. The Portuguese’s strike was a majestic right-foot effort from outside the area and he is now the top scorer in the competitio­n with nine goals. Borja Mayoral hit Real’s opener but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ang’s brace pegged back Real, before Lucas Vasquez’s 81st-minute winner. Real finish second to Tottenham in Group H. Elsewhere, there was late drama as Group G winners Besiktas beat RB Leipzig 2-1. A penalty from former Manchester City striker Alvaro Negredo put the Turkish champions ahead, but Naby Keita, who will join Liverpool in the summer, levelled for Leipzig in the 87th minute. Anderson Talisca hit the winner three minutes later.
